When was the last time two brothers both hit home runs in the same game? (Either as team-mates or opponents is fine)

I will say on May 28, 1996, when Cal Ripken hit a two-run home run in the fourth inning, giving the Orioles the lead for good with a grand slam in the seventh inning, and added another two-run home run in the ninth inning.
His brother Billy Ripken also hit a home run in the ninth inning, and the Orioles defeated the Seattle Mariners, 12-8.
It was just the second time the Ripken brothers had both hit a home run in the same game.

I don't usually like to answer my own questions, but since I have found out some more recent occurrences than the Cal & Billy Ripken case in 1996 I may as well share them in case anyone is interested.

Bret and Aaron Boone homered in the same game twice (Sept 1st 1999 and May 11th 2000), although bizarrely both times they were on opposite sides when Bret came back to Cincinatti on a road trip with the Braves.

More recent though is the case of Jason and Jeremy Giambi, who did this 4 times while team-mates at Oakland... the most recent case was August 11th 2001 in a victory over the Yankees. So as far as I know this is the most recent instance, although there are a handful of sibling duos I have yet to check out that may steal the honour.

edit - July 31st 2005, Bengie and Jose Molina both homered for the Angels in a loss at Yankee Stadium.
